Artist Richard Mosse documents humanitarian crises and environmental catastrophes by making the unseen visible. This film follows Mosse and his collaborators Ben Frost and Trevor Tweeten as they travel across the world to film under-reported world events in zones of conflict, repurposing surveillance technologies and scientific tools to capture stories and scenes that evoke deeper understanding and motivate audiences to act.

“My power, if I have any,” says Mosse, “is to be able to show you the things that I’ve seen in a more powerful way than perhaps the pictures you’ve seen in the newspaper of the same thing.” 

Richard Mosse’s work calls specific attention to the tools we use to capture and distribute information about global events. The artist uses multispectral imaging, cameras that capture ultraviolet light, and tropes of Western media to show audiences the various scales and impacts of deforestation in the Amazon as well as their own implication in it. “We can’t see the climate changing, and that’s really the inherent problem,” says Mosse. “It’s on a scale beyond what we can perceive.”

This film is from the Art21 digital series “Extended Play”. Art21 is the world’s leading source to learn directly from the artists of our time. A nonprofit organisation, their mission is to educate and expand access to contemporary art, producing documentary films, resources and public programs.
